US Destroys Six Iranian Boats, Intercepts Missiles in Strait of Hormuz Operation

- Advertisement -

The US military has destroyed six Iranian small boats and intercepted cruise missiles and drones fired by Tehran as part of an operation to free up shipping through the Strait of Hormuz. This announcement was made by US Admiral Brad Cooper, head of Central Command, on Monday.

Admiral Cooper advised Iranian forces to stay clear of US military assets during this operation. He also confirmed that a blockade of Iran remains in effect, preventing ships from entering or leaving Iranian territory and exceeding expectations.
